WebApr 28, 2016 · Activity points. 14,193. Make sure the zener diode is not faulty. A shorted or very leaky diode will tend to shut down the regulator or keep the output voltage very low. The 33 k resistor value seems a bit low for me. Without seeing the complete circuit, it will keep the opto on. WebMar 8, 2024 · Speaker crackling is almost always caused by a connection problem. Someplace between your amplifier and your speaker driver, there’s a bad wire which is causing the driver to move abruptly, causing interference. The challenge- the bad connection could be in a number of different places, some easier to address than others.
